Expansionary monetary policy means that a central bank is using its tools to manipulate the economy. It does that by increasing the money supply, aggregate demand and <em>lowering the interest rates</em>. This type of policy is opposite to the contractionary monetary policy.
On the other side, when government spending increases the budget deficit, the Treasury issues more bonds. This reduces the price of bonds and <em>raise the interest rate</em>. Or in our example, the aforementioned lower interest rate gets back to where it was. This process could lead to disruption in the economy.

</span><span>object permanence refers to the understanding that an object will still remain in a place even though we stop observing it directly.
</span>This psychological phenomenon is the one that make children think their parents is disappearing when they're playing peek-a-boo.

Self-serving bias is a person's tendency to attribute all the success to the internal factors such as their abilities and efforts. Whereas, all the failures or the unsuccessful outcomes are ascribed to the external factors such as unfavorable situations. Self-serving bias is a method of maintaining one's self-esteem.
